Dredge’s New Update

First up, one of my candidates for Game of the Year, Dredge, has received another free update.

In the new update, players get to fish for an additional 13 creepy crustaceans while engaging the services of a new NPC, the ‘Painter’ to give their vessel a new lick of paint (and a flag).

NASCAR Arcade Rush – Out Now!

Next, NASCAR Arcade Rush has been released for the PS5, PS4, Xbox Series X|S,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ch and PC via Steam. Players get to jump into the driver’s seat for heart-pumping, high-speed NASCAR competition and excitement on wildly reimagined versions of the motorsport’s most iconic racetracks.

Players get to customize both car and driver as they compete to take the top position across a variety of game modes, including the Career NASCAR Cup Series plus online and local multiplayer.

Baldur’s Gate 3 Patch 3 Brings Full Mac Support and Magic Mirror

In more recent news, Baldur’s Gate 3 is now available on the Mac in it’s full release form and with this new update, dubbed Patch 3, the critically-acclaimed RPG finally allows players to change their characters’ appearance in-game via the Magic Mirror.

The Magic Mirror lives in the party’s camp and allows players to change up their appearance whenever they’d like. There are some restrictions: your appearance, voice, pronouns and nether region can be changed, but race/subrace and body type cannot. Origin characters, hirelings, and full illithids cannot use the Magic Mirror, and any cosmetic modifications that are a consequence of gameplay choices will persist. Hehehe.

MythForce – Saturday Morning Cartoon Roguelite – Out Now!

Developer Beamdog and publisher Aspyr have announced that the first-person roguelike action game MythForce™ is out now on PlayStation®5, PlayStation®4, Xbox Series X|S,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, and Steam, and has officially exited early access on the Epic Games Store.

Set in a fantasy world inspired by 1980s-era cartoons, the full launch of MythForce grows the adventure with new story episodes, unlockable difficulty modes for greater challenges, and an overhaul of the meta-progression system. MythForce is available on all platforms for $29.99, and a Deluxe Edition featuring the base game, original soundtrack and art book is available on Steam for $39.99.
